We meet at the Orange County Hispanic Chamber of Commerce at 2130 E. Fourth Street, Suite 160, Santa Ana, CA 92705. Meetings will start at 6:30 PM and end at 7:35 PM. There is parking available in the rear of the building. For more information, please call 714-352-0312.

Latin Leaders is a Toastmasters International club which meets every Tuesday night from 6:30 to 7:35. Our club is bilingual. The first Tuesday of every month we hold the meeting in Spanish and encourage our members to do their presentations/table topics in Spanish, although it is optional and you may speak in either English or Spanish at any time. We strive to have two speakers every week and a table topics session to give an opportunity for everyone to practice speaking. Additionally, all members participate in meeting roles in an organized environment. Our focus is to improve leadership skills as well as speaking skills in a way that is enjoyable.
The feedback from most people who visit us (and most of them join us) is that our club is very supportive of all members, encouraging participation and providing positive feedback for the development of our members - but you should experience that for yourself. You are welcome to join us as a guest any time and let us know what you think. Our Mission
Our mission is to provide a mutually supportive and positive learning environment in which every member has the opportunity to develop communication and leadership skills, which in turn foster self-confidence and personal growth.
